    Move Monthly Data (January, February) into New Columns

    Hello,

    I am looking for a simple solution to a problem I have been having. I work with performance data, and I often have a situation where I receive data in a monthly format (January Sales, February Sales). The issue is that we have people starting at different times of the year, so some people might start in January, and some people might start in June. This poses a difficult for some of my analyses, so what I would like to do is to transfer this data into Month 1, Month 2, Month 3, etc. columns.

    I know that probably is not very clear, so I am attaching an image. You can see that some people start in January, February, March, April, May, June. During this time, people have sales data for each month after they start (unless they turnover). What I would like to do is move a person's first month of data into the Month 1 column, no matter when that person's first month is.

    I am trying to avoid very very complex formulas, as we often have to deal with data like this. Ideally, I would like to create a template, where I can take 36 months of data (January 2012 - December 2015, for instance), paste it into an Excel template, and have the template generate Month 1, Month 2, Month 3, etc.
